Abstract :

The quality of water is an important criterion for evaluating its suitability for drinking, irrigation and fish culture.The influence of monthly and seasonal changes on the physic-chemical parameters of water body. Therefore a study has been conducted on the Wardhannapet fresh water lake in Warangal. This investigation has been carried out for a period of one year from June 2018 to May 2019.The water quality parameters considered in the present study water temperature ranged from 23.00⁰ C to 31.00⁰C,Total Dissolved Solids from 35.50 to 47.60 (mg/l),Transparency from 40.00 to 55.70(Cm);pH from 6.45 to 7.50; Dissolved Oxygen from 7.5 to 8.6 (mg/l);Biological Oxygen Demand from 3.0 to 6.3(mg/l); free CO2 from 1.60 to 2.10(mg/l); Total Alkalinity from 35.10 to 55.60(mg/l);Chloride from 35.20 to 49.55(mg/l);Phosphate(PO4) from 1.45 to 2.00(mg/l);Sulphate(SO4) from 25.20 to 45.10(mg/l);Nitrate from 0.22 to 0.55(mg/l);Ammonia from 0.65 to 1.46(ppm) and Electrical Conductivity from 110.0 to 130.10(µmchos/cm).The study revealed that variation in parameters from month to month in a year has been noted at different sampling stations. However, the overall physic-chemical parameters of the lake water remained within the tolerable range throught the study period. The observations on the present study suggest that the fish culture in this fresh water lake can be taken up and the quality of the water is suitable for it.
